I received wrong information from people in the Portugal RE industry before so I'm not super confident the person I talked to is correct I'm just trying to get more data points.In case it's useful for others these are some other bits of info I've learnedRefinancing is possible but it is more expensive than conventional (usually the spread is 1-2% higher) and it is necessary to explain to the bank what will be done with the money.It is not necessary to wait to own the property for a certain time to obtain mortgage credit.
